Kekedid
Habitat:Temperate regions of Katavyan, Ta'Raekhet and Mitralon.
Description:A spring green along their carapaces and leaf-shaped wings, the male specimens of this katydid cousin are bright displays. Conversely, the female coloration ranges closer to dark tans and light browns.
Notes:The females are not known to chirrup, but the male calls of the kekedid are legendary, mentioned in many texts, and span the known world. Infamous for the loud, brash and highly repetitious "keke!", they can be heard and detested for miles.

No one likes them. Ever.

Easily found, harder to catch. The kekedid can leap many yards in a single bound, aided over distance by their wings.
